The Opportunity
This position works out of our LIMA, PERU location in the CHR division.
As the Talent Deployment Specialist, you鈥檒l have the chance to Conduct analyzes and studies to support management in developing and administering effective compensation and benefits programs in accordance with the organization's reward strategy.
What You鈥檒l Do
Serve as technical mobility expert in region leveraging expertise in the mobility compliance space, including immigration and relocation compliance
Manage and coordinate day-to-day activities of all mobility programs in region including assignment and transfer administration activities
Advise business in region and help them identify applicable program and structure;
Provide mobility-related expertise, consultation and cost estimates for assignment transfer.
Support payroll and tax compliance process with outside tax vendor and payroll team.
Works closely with outside vendor to manage all international relocations
Consults and provides relocation related expertise to hiring managers, recruiters, and business partners to facilitate their use of relocation policies, procedures, and practices
Assist accounting and payroll in the reporting and management of relocation accruals
Identify opportunities to build know-how and leverage best practices for continuous improvement on Global Mobility
Ensure adherence to corporate compliance, legal, and regulatory standards
Provides ongoing reports, and cost analysis to assist management decision-making process
Ensure operations and processes are both efficient and scalable
Required Qualifications
Bachelor degree
Fluent English
Minimun 2 years of experience in HR focus, finance, compliance, service center, governability
